For your larger pleco, it's definitely a Pterygoplichthys of some kind. From the photos, I can't tell between and . From the underbelly, I'm leaning towards P. disjunctivus because of the scrolling pattern. From the side view, I'm leaning towards P. joselimaianus because of the pale spots on the head and body with what appears to be a dark background color. A better photo of the whole body from a side view with dorsal fin flared would be helpful.
